Talin is the tomb of the monks of Shaolin Temple. After the death of the famous and high-ranking monks in the Buddhist world, their ashes or bones were placed in the underground palace, and towers were built on them to show merit. The difference in the shape of the tower, the size of the tower, the size of the masonry, and so on, all reflect the status and achievements of the deceased in Buddhism. The Tallinn tower has only four levels, one, three, five, and seven levels. The shape is square, hexagonal, and horn.

Shaolin Temple Talin, located in Henan Dengfeng Shaolin Temple about 300 meters west of the foot of the mountain, out of Shaolin Temple Tibetan Jingge to the direction of the ropeway. This is the cemetery of the monks of Shaolin Temple. It has preserved 241 masonry tomb towers from Tang Zhenyuan 7 (AD 791) to Qing Jiaqing 8 (AD 1803). The variety, shape and height are varied and may be related to status. The Tallinn of Shaolin Temple is the tomb with the largest number of ancient towers in China, listed as a key cultural relics protection unit in the country, and is one of the components of the world cultural heritage of Dengfeng's historical building complex.
